ISLA 537 Summer Introductory Arabic 2 (9 credits)

Note: This is the 2020–2021 eCalendar. Update the year in your browser's URL bar for the most recent version of this page, or .

Offered by: Islamic Studies (Faculty of Arts)

Overview

Islamic Studies : Introduction to fundamental grammatical structures.

  • Prerequisite: Department placement test, instructor approval.

  • Students at this level have studied Arabic for the equivalent of a semester (3 months) in a formal setting and have knowledge of the Arabic alphabet. They have a limited vocabulary and can read short sentences and have covered some basic grammatical structures such as the demonstrative nouns and the nominal sentence. They can produce some formulaic, memorized simple phrases and sentences that describe themselves, where they live, and people they know.
